英文摘要
The applicant is internationally recognized as a world leader in the areas of synthesis, structural characterization, property evaluation and commercial applications of nanostructured materials (metals, alloys, metal-matrix composites) made by electrodeposition. Over the past three decades his groundbreaking work has not only provided a solid fundamental understanding of the nanostructure electrodeposition process, and the physical, chemical and mechanical properties of fully dense nanomaterials, but also contributed to the first industrial applications of such materials in the world. Building on the knowledge base established over the past 30 years, the applicant' s research efforts over the next five years will focus on the next generation of nanostructures produced by electrochemical synthesis and other methods in two specific areas: grain boundary engineered materials from nanocrystalline precursors and moth eye/lotus leaf type bio-inspired nanostructured surfaces.
